Heads up for whoever touches this next: the relevance scores on Quillsearch got weird after we bumped the phrase-match boost. Exact title matches were drowning out fresher docs, so I rebalanced the decay curve and trimmed the synonym expansion weight. Don't tweak these independently — they interact in annoying ways, and the eval suite in /relevance-bench is the only safe way to check. Current values are below.

tuning table, fawip-fahag:
WEIGHTS = {
    "novwyn": 452,
    "casdor": 675,
}

## Deploying the Gatewick Proctor Queue

Deploys are pretty painless: push to main, wait for the pipeline, then watch the queue drain dashboard for five minutes. If candidates pile up mid-exam, roll back first and ask questions later — the queue replays safely. Everything the workers care about lives in one config block, shown here for reference.

settings of bafof-yagef:
JOROX_PIN=8740
JOROX_TENANT=pelox
JOROX_METRICS_HOST=metrics.jorox.qorvelworks.internal
JOROX_SEAL=seal_c78f63c1
JOROX_STANDBY_TEAM=norax

Quick note on how the billing worker handles blue-green deploys at Torvane: the green pool spins up alongside blue, drains invoice jobs from the Quillbatch queue, and only takes traffic once the health probe passes three consecutive checks. Don't merge anything that skips the drain step — we learned that the hard way during the Larkfield incident. To smoke-test the green pool locally against the staging ledger, you'll need the internal Quillbatch key below.

service key, fawip-bajef: kto11_Qt5wZK9vdNC

## Local Setup: Connection Pooling

The Moorfield service uses a pooled connection layer with a default cap of 20 connections per worker. Pool sizing is read from the local config at startup; release builds must not override it at runtime. To verify pooling behaves correctly before tagging a release, start the service against the staging database using the connection string below.

primary connection of tajeg-tajop = postgresql://julax_svc:DI@db-e7f3.kelvidyn.corp:5432/rusdor